Samsung is all set to push the new Android 9 Pie update on the Samsung Galaxy S9+ later this year. Now XDA Developers had managed to get the new Android 9 Pie firmware file for the Galaxy S9+ which has now revealed some of the features of the upcoming flagship Samsung Galaxy S10.

Samsung Galaxy S10

As per the source, the firmware teardown revealed the presence of not three but four Samsung Galaxy S10 models. This is not the first time earlier the same source had revealed the list of 2018 devices from Samsung. Anyway, as per the firmware file, the Samsung Galaxy S10 will have four models with codenamed as beyond 0, beyond 1, beyond 2, beyond 2 5G.

As per the source, the Samsung Galaxy S10 with codenamed beyond 0 is the base and cheapest variant under the series. The beyond 1 is the intermediate whereas the beyond 2 is the higher variant. The topmost variant will come with 5G support. Do note that the letter q with the codename stands for the Qualcomm chipset if the codename is without the letter its Exynos chipset.

Apart from this, nothing much about the device is leaked. So we can expect the all four models of the Samsung Galaxy S10 to come with SD855/Exynos 9820 SoC next year. So Samsung might become the first OEM to launch the world’s first 5G smartphone next year.
